The Araca Group, founded in 1997 by Matthew Rego, Michael Rego, and Hank Unger, is a highly respected and multifaceted theatrical production and live event merchandising company. Headquartered in New York City, Araca has a significant global presence with offices and operations in Los Angeles, Las Vegas, London, Sydney, and Melbourne. The company has been instrumental in producing and/or merchandising over 350 theatrical productions and live events across the globe, ranging from Broadway hits like 'Wicked,' 'Book of Mormon,' and 'Hadestown' to various touring productions and special events. They offer a comprehensive suite of services including creative development, production financing and management, marketing, and the design, sourcing, and sale of merchandise, making them a key partner for many successful live entertainment ventures.

Playbill • February 11, 2024
'Gutenberg! The Musical!', co-produced by The Araca Group and starring Josh Gad and Andrew Rannells, concluded its critically acclaimed limited Broadway engagement on February 11, 2024, at the James Earl Jones Theatre. The Araca Group was among the producers of this hit show....more
BroadwayWorld • October 27, 2023
As the long-standing merchandising partner for the iconic Broadway musical 'Wicked,' The Araca Group celebrated the show's 20th anniversary in October 2023. They rolled out exclusive anniversary-themed merchandise, reinforcing their significant role in enhancing the fan experience and managing brand legacies for major theatrical productions....more
The Araca Group Website • Ongoing
The Araca Group consistently manages merchandising for a premier portfolio of Broadway shows, including 'Hamilton,' 'MJ The Musical,' 'Moulin Rouge! The Musical,' and '& Juliet.' Their expertise in creating and distributing compelling merchandise plays a vital role in extending the theatrical experience for audiences....more
